logo
1
1
WeChat Login
ge56_尝试ch72模块增加wps
2026_02_26_1860-wmtag_memo_分支_ge32_docs:_更新文档以反映从NoteGen切换到Obsidian的变更_里程碑版_重要提交

日志目录 (logs/)

本目录存放 XFCE4 桌面环境的运行日志和进程 ID 文件。

📑 目录导航

📁 文件说明

日志文件

文件名称功能说明
desktop.logXFCE4 桌面环境启动和运行日志
x11vnc.logVNC 服务器运行日志
websockify.lognoVNC WebSocket 代理日志
installation.log安装过程日志(由安装脚本生成)
controller.log主控制器运行日志

PID 文件

文件名称功能说明
xvfb.pidXvfb 虚拟显示服务器进程 ID
xfce.pidXFCE4 桌面会话进程 ID
websockify.pidWebSocket 代理进程 ID
controller.pid主控制器进程 ID

📊 日志查看

通过 Makefile

make logs # 列出所有日志文件 make tail # 实时查看桌面日志 make tail-all # 实时查看所有日志

直接查看

# 查看桌面日志 cat logs/desktop.log # 实时查看 tail -f logs/desktop.log # 查看所有日志 tail -f logs/*.log

🔍 日志分析

常见问题排查

# 检查启动错误 grep -i error logs/desktop.log grep -i fail logs/desktop.log # 检查连接问题 grep -i connect logs/websockify.log grep -i timeout logs/websockify.log # 检查 VNC 问题 grep -i error logs/x11vnc.log

日志轮转

日志文件会持续增长,建议定期清理:

# 清理日志(重置环境时自动执行) make reset # 或手动清理 rm -f logs/*.log

🗑️ 清理日志

# 通过 Makefile make reset # 停止服务并清理日志 # 手动清理 rm -f logs/*.log logs/*.pid

⚠️ 注意事项

  1. 日志文件可能包含敏感信息,请注意保护
  2. 清理日志前请先停止桌面服务
  3. PID 文件用于服务管理,请勿手动删除
  4. 日志目录会在服务启动时自动创建

最后更新: 2026-02-26